Responsibilities
- Develop, design, build, or purchase manufacturing workstations and equipment.
- Collaborate with equipment integrators from development to operations handoff.
- Install, commission, and qualify new equipment and fixtures.
- Provide Design for Manufacturability (DFM) feedback to the engineering team.
- Document robust processes ensuring safety, uptime, and quality.
- Debug and resolve time-sensitive issues with manufacturing equipment and processes.
- Train hands-on labor on new manufacturing equipment and processes.
Job Requirements
- BS in Engineering; advanced degrees are a plus.
- 3+ years of equipment or manufacturing engineering experience in an electro-mechanical assembly environment.
- Ability to support the purchase and setup of novel automated manufacturing equipment.
- Experience in writing Standard Operating Procedures and manufacturing documentation.
- Collaboration skills with design engineers for DFM feedback.
- Hands-on experience in building and testing workstations and equipment.
- Strong communication skills and readiness to interact with various professionals and suppliers.
